The Texas Department of Transportation is seeking contractors to perform repairs on crash cushion attenuators under solicitation number 6501-01-001, with responses due by August 11, 2026. This solicitation is issued under NAICS code 811121, which pertains to automotive repair and maintenance services, and is targeted at state, local, and educational government entities. Work must be performed in Harris County, Texas, and all proposals must meet the technical and operational standards required for highway safety equipment repair. The contract is open to qualified vendors capable of safely and efficiently restoring crash cushions to federal and state compliance specifications, ensuring continued protection for motorists. There is no set-aside designation applied to this opportunity, meaning all eligible businesses may compete.
